Is there any listing anywhere of what the Pre-defined EEPs do?  I would like
to create a custom one that consists of exactly what a Pre-Defined one does
plus adding one line of my own code. i.e add a line of code to a button that
I have set up to use 'Add a new Row"

Lin,

Here you go ...


Add Row
Inserts a new row into the table

Add Row and Exit
Inserts a new row into the table and immediately exits form

Delete Row
Deletes the current row from the table. Used after row has been saved or
when form is in edit mode

Discard Row
Discards the unsaved row from the table when form is in enter mode

Discard Row and Exit
Discards the unsaved row from the table when form is in enter mode and
immediately exits the form

Duplicate Row
Duplicates the current row in the table

Exit
Immediately closes form and returns to program

Next Row
Advances to the next row in the record set

Next Table
Advances to the next table

Previous Row
Advances to the previous row in the record set

Previous Table
Advances to the previous table

Save Row
Saves all changes made to data and resets flag

Last Row
Advances to the last row in the record set

First Row
Advances to the first row in the record set

Save Row and Exit
Saves all changes made to data and resets flag before immediately
exiting the form

Refresh Current Table
Refreshes the records in the current table to reflect any changes made
since the last refresh
